Output 68fab3a2024a03179b5270a3c87b200cd1d6089a03466e19f6d1b138d05ebb64:1

value
622850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37060f131a65e745f2003e8888eea11446b611ee OP_EQUALVERIFY OP_CHECKSIG
address
161wRXhuG9zSaHiB3s8DSbkfSAmh5jjHJi
transaction
68fab3a2024a03179b5270a3c87b200cd1d6089a03466e19f6d1b138d05ebb64
spent
true